While I'm not an expert on Anti Seize, Tapers or anything else for that matter here is what I can contribute to this thread.

During the manufacture and assembly of industrial machinery it is standard practice to assemble all Taper Fits clean and dry, meaning no lubricants or corrosion preventatives. This includes both friction only tapers and fastener secured tapers.


The Instructions for all of the Taper Lock Bushings we install clearly state DO NOT OIL OR GREASE BUSHING OR HUB BEFORE INSTALLATION.


While the appearance of the Taper Lock and the BJ stud is different the function for both is the same, to lock the components together in a non-permanent fashion.
